HarborOne Bank is Hiring a Data Manager Near Brockton, MA

Overview

Who We Are:

For over a century, HarborOne’s mission has not wavered, total commitment to our customers, our communities, and our colleagues. Founded in 1917 to serve the growing financial needs of our local communities, HarborOne continues to honor and embrace its commitment to strengthen and empower the communities where our customers and employees live and work.

Today, HarborOne has 30 branches in southeastern Massachusetts and Rhode Island and 2 commercial lending offices in Boston and Providence. Our corporate values of accountability, integrity, respect, trust and teamwork are core to how we manage our business and our relationships with our customers. Working at HarborOne will give you a great career with opportunities to learn, grow and make an impact, along with the power to make a difference.

Job Description:.

HarborOne Bank is hiring a hands-on AVP, Data and Application Manager. This role reports to the FVP, IT Operations and EPMO and is accountable for management of our data platform and all internal application development activities at HarborOne Bank. This role is responsible for actively contributing to coding and development tasks while overseeing the entire software development lifecycle, from concept to delivery. This leader manages a small but growing team of BI analysts and developers.

This role is key to shaping and executing HarborOne Bank’s technology road map with a focus on leading edge digital and data capabilities that optimize the customer experience. While leading this team and function for HarborOne Bank this leader will roll-up their sleeves and drive outcomes on critical initiatives. This important role is highly visible and will interact with Business Heads and others on the HarborOne senior leadership team.

Responsibilities

Responsibilities:

Technical Delivery

  • Effectively understand, design, develop, and support technical solutions to defined business needs.
  • Hands-on development of software solutions, including coding, debugging, code reviews, and troubleshooting.
  • Partnering with the EPMO, serve as the accountable delivery leader for technology execution through build, test, and implementation.
  • Collaborate with the Infrastructure team, Desktop Computing team and Information Security Officer to ensure all aspects of compliance, supportability, and maintainability and information security are incorporated in solutions.

Team Management

  • Lead a team of BI analysts and developers in designing, implementing, and maintaining software applications.
  • Provide technical guidance and mentorship to team members, fostering a culture of learning and innovation.

Leadership

  • Develop, implement, and manage technology and data solutions across HarborOne Bank.
  • Serve as technical expert on all in-house development tools to provide architectural and technical inputs and oversight for projects.
  • Stay up-to-date with emerging technologies and industry trends, incorporating them into the development process as appropriate.
  • Adhere to development policies, procedures, and standards.
  • Generate and manage quality control reports, management reports, status reports and system assessment reports

Qualifications

Required Skills:

  • Bachelor’s degree, in Computer Science or related field is required. Master’s degree a plus.
  • 8-10 years of software development, with a focus on data architecture, database design, scripting, third party integration and API development.
  • Operates with a risk management mindset with a deep understanding of data security, privacy, and building auditable controls.
  • Experienced in Data warehousing, involving complex data transformation, pivot tables, complex calculators, SQL queries, and stored procs /functions.
  • Experience using Snowflake tools (e.g. Snowpipe, Snowpark, etc.) and advanced concepts such as resource monitoring, virtual warehousing, performance tuning etc.
  • Experienced in Python programming language and invoking python functions from Snowflake.
  • Perform ELT/ETL development optimized for efficient storage and low-cost data retrieval needs.
  • Experience with AWS, Github, DBT, Snowflake, PowerBI and Rivery preferred.
  • Exposure to one or more popular low-code/no-code platforms (e.g. Creatio)
  • Exposure to Workday EIB, Creatio, and AI (e.g. Machine Learning) a plus.
  • Recent relevant experience in Banking/Financial Services defining, understanding, and improving banking processes/technology and a proven successful track record of effective management of staff members and initiatives.
  • Certifications in Snowflake, AWS, Microsoft Azure, API a differentiator

About HarborOne Bank

HarborOne Bank, headquartered in Massachusetts, has $4.61 billion in assets. For over a century, HarborOne's mission has not waveredtotal commitment to our customers, our communities, and our colleagues. Today, we serve communities in Massachusetts and Rhode Island with the very best in personal and small business banking products and services delivered through 25 full-service branches, and a full suite of online, mobile banking, and cash management services. We provide mortgage lending throughout New England as the parent company of HarborOne Mortgage. Our consumer lending business extends th ... roughout Massachusetts and Rhode Island, as does our Commercial Lending business. Our Commercial Lending team is comprised of seasoned veterans who specialize in meeting the needs of todays business leaders who need big bank services with the local bank feel. Loans, lines of credit, cash management services, and commercial real estate are our areas of expertise. Our lenders are headquartered at our Corporate Office in Brockton and at our Commercial Loan Offices in Providence, RI and in Boston. HarborOne was established in 1917 as Brockton Credit Union, changing our name to HarborOne Credit Union in 2004. In July 2013 HarborOne converted to a bank to provide more opportunities for growth and to better meet the needs of those who wanted to do business with us. Deposits are insured by the Federal Deposit Insurance Corporation (FDIC) and also by the Depositors Insurance Fund, (DIF). More
